Apple's New Smart Home Doorbell with Face ID Unlocks Your Door
Apple is reportedly working on a new smart home doorbell with advanced facial recognition technology that could compete with products like Ring, according to Mark Gurman from Bloomberg.
- Apple reportedly working on smart home doorbell with Face ID support
- Doorbell to compete with likes of Ring and offer advanced facial recognition
- Would integrate wirelessly with smart home locks, automatically unlock door by scanning face
- Still in early stages and won't come to market until at least end of next year
- Apple expected to expand significantly in smart home space in 2023, including new control device, refreshed Apple TV, HomePod mini
